Dela via


Availability Sets - List Available Sizes

Visar en lista över alla tillgängliga storlekar på virtuella datorer som kan användas för att skapa en ny virtuell dator i en befintlig tillgänglighetsuppsättning.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Compute/availabilitySets/{availabilitySetName}/vmSizes?api-version=2025-04-01

URI-parametrar

Name I Obligatorisk Typ Description
availabilitySetName
path True

string

Namnet på tillgänglighetsuppsättningen.

resourceGroupName
path True

string

minLength: 1
maxLength: 90

Namnet på resursgruppen. Namnet är skiftlägesokänsligt.

subscriptionId
path True

string

minLength: 1

ID för målprenumerationen.

api-version
query True

string

minLength: 1

Den API-version som ska användas för den här åtgärden.

Svar

Name Typ Description
200 OK

VirtualMachineSizeListResult

Azure-åtgärden har slutförts.

Other Status Codes

CloudError

Ett oväntat felsvar.

Säkerhet

azure_auth

Azure Active Directory OAuth2-flöde.

Typ: oauth2
Flow: implicit
Auktoriseringswebbadress: https://login.microsoftonline.com/common/oauth2/authorize

Omfattningar

Name Description
user_impersonation personifiera ditt användarkonto

Exempel

AvailabilitySet_ListAvailableSizes_MaximumSet_Gen
AvailabilitySet_ListAvailableSizes_MinimumSet_Gen

AvailabilitySet_ListAvailableSizes_MaximumSet_Gen

Exempelbegäran

GET https://management.azure.com/subscriptions/{subscription-id}/resourceGroups/rgcompute/providers/Microsoft.Compute/availabilitySets/aaaaaaaaaaaaaaaaaaaa/vmSizes?api-version=2025-04-01

Exempelsvar

{
  "value": [
    {
      "name": "Standard_A1_V2",
      "numberOfCores": 1,
      "osDiskSizeInMB": 1047552,
      "resourceDiskSizeInMB": 10240,
      "memoryInMB": 2048,
      "maxDataDiskCount": 2
    },
    {
      "name": "Standard_A2_V2",
      "numberOfCores": 2,
      "osDiskSizeInMB": 1047552,
      "resourceDiskSizeInMB": 20480,
      "memoryInMB": 4096,
      "maxDataDiskCount": 4
    }
  ]
}

AvailabilitySet_ListAvailableSizes_MinimumSet_Gen

Exempelbegäran

GET https://management.azure.com/subscriptions/{subscription-id}/resourceGroups/rgcompute/providers/Microsoft.Compute/availabilitySets/aa/vmSizes?api-version=2025-04-01

Exempelsvar

{}

Definitioner

Name Description
ApiError

API-fel.

ApiErrorBase

bas för API-fel.

CloudError

Ett felsvar från beräkningstjänsten.

InnerError

Inre felinformation.

VirtualMachineSize

Beskriver egenskaperna för en VM-storlek.

VirtualMachineSizeListResult

Åtgärdssvaret för listan över virtuella datorer.

ApiError

API-fel.

Name Typ Description
code

string

Felkoden.

details

ApiErrorBase[]

Information om API-fel

innererror

InnerError

Det inre API-felet

message

string

Felmeddelandet.

target

string

Målet för det specifika felet.

ApiErrorBase

bas för API-fel.

Name Typ Description
code

string

Felkoden.

message

string

Felmeddelandet.

target

string

Målet för det specifika felet.

CloudError

Ett felsvar från beräkningstjänsten.

Name Typ Description
error

ApiError

API-fel.

InnerError

Inre felinformation.

Name Typ Description
errordetail

string

Det interna felmeddelandet eller undantagsdumpen.

exceptiontype

string

Typen av undantag.

VirtualMachineSize

Beskriver egenskaperna för en VM-storlek.

Name Typ Description
maxDataDiskCount

integer (int32)

Det maximala antalet datadiskar som kan kopplas till storleken på den virtuella datorn.

memoryInMB

integer (int32)

Mängden minne i MB som stöds av storleken på den virtuella datorn.

name

string

Namnet på storleken på den virtuella datorn.

numberOfCores

integer (int32)

Antalet kärnor som stöds av storleken på den virtuella datorn. För begränsade vCPU-kompatibla VM-storlekar representerar det här talet det totala antalet virtuella processorer för kvoten som den virtuella datorn använder. För korrekt vCPU-antal, se https://docs.microsoft.com/azure/virtual-machines/constrained-vcpu eller https://docs.microsoft.com/rest/api/compute/resourceskus/list

osDiskSizeInMB

integer (int32)

Storleken på OS-disken, i MB, som tillåts av storleken på den virtuella datorn.

resourceDiskSizeInMB

integer (int32)

Resursdiskens storlek, i MB, som tillåts av storleken på den virtuella datorn.

VirtualMachineSizeListResult

Åtgärdssvaret för listan över virtuella datorer.

Name Typ Description
nextLink

string

Länken till nästa sida med objekt.

value

VirtualMachineSize[]

Listan över storlekar på virtuella datorer.